Location: No 72/2, Varthur Hobli Bellandur(560103) Landmark: LandLine No: 18001200330 | Mobile No: 18002678622 | Petrol Pumps Nayara Petrol Bunks Nayara Petrol Pumps Petrol Bunks Show More Hide embedgooglemap.org